Woodruff Arts Center is a prestigious cultural institution located in Atlanta, Georgia, renowned for its significant contributions to the arts and education. As the nation's third largest arts center, it serves as a home for three major art partners: the Alliance Theatre, the Atlanta Symphony Orchestra, and the High Museum of Art. The Woodruff Arts Center plays an integral role in promoting artistic excellence, providing education, and fostering community engagement through diverse artistic disciplines. The organization is deeply committed to enriching the cultural landscape by offering world-class performances, exhibits, and educational experiences to audiences of all ages.

Job Duties

  • Work directly with the venue and touring party to retrieve and deliver items from local stores, restaurants, airports, hotels, laundry facilities, etc.
  • providing first-class transportation service for an Artist's touring party in a company vehicle
  • assist in ordering meals and after-show food
  • maintain show cash and receipts throughout the day
  • assist with miscellaneous projects as directed by Atlanta Symphony Hall LIVE's Event Manager or a member of the Artist's Touring Party
  • maintain a professional and personable attitude with the venue and touring personnel
  • assist touring and venue personnel in setting up production and dressing rooms with hospitality
